Abstract: This report presents the results from measurements of interdomain traffic traces. It discusses the implications of interdomain traffic characterization on the feasibility of interdomain traffic engineering. In the first part, we study the relationship between interdomain traffic and the routing view of the Internet. Our contributions are the following. The distribution of the traffic received by the studied ISPs is uneven with respect to the "distance" from which the traffic is generated by ... (Update)
